Library Regulations

The Library and its facilities are for the use of the Staff and Students of Marino Institute of Education.
Entry to the Library and borrowing privileges are provided on the production of a valid MIE Student or Staff card.
Cards must be produced or surrendered if required to do so by a member of the Library staff.
Cards are non-transferable and must only be used by the owner of the card. Improper use of a card may incur a fine.

All Library users are expected to:

  • Observe the regulations in place for the use of the Library and Library material 
  • Treat Library staff with courtesy and respect 
  • Respect the rights of other Library users

No Library book may be taken out of the Library building except a book of which the loan is permitted and has been recorded by the Library system as being on loan to the reader.

Borrowers are responsible for any items on their card until they are returned and discharged from their account. 

Mutilation or defacement of any book or article of Library property is regarded as an offence.

Readers are not allowed to bring visitors into the Library. Admission to the Library is at the discretion of the Librarian.

Readers are not permitted to reserve seats by leaving their belongings or books on seats and desks.

Readers are at all times responsible for their own property.

Readers are reminded to be aware of the 24-hour CCTV security system throughout the Library.

Readers are required to comply with the provisions of S.I. No. 277/2020 - Copyright and Related Rights (Certification of Licensing Scheme For Higher Education Institutions) (The Irish Copyright Licensing Agency Limited) Order 2020. Failure to comply may expose the person to potential civil liability and, in the case of a student or staff member of College, to College disciplinary procedures. The attention of readers is drawn to the notice on display beside the photocopying machines in the Library. See Copyright and Related Rights Act (2020) for more details.

Sanctions for Breach of Library Regulations

Breach of the Library regulations will result in sanction by the Librarian. Appeal against a Library penalty or decision may be made to the Registrar. Penalties may include fines, administrative and other charges, ejection and temporary or permanent exclusion from the Library and/or the confiscation of any personal property brought into or used within the Library in breach of Library regulations.

The Library shall not be responsible, in any way whatsoever, for any property so confiscated.
